让我在序言中说,我没有大量的Javascript经验。我有一个CSS类,专门用来显示/隐藏东西的按钮点击我的网站。进度条在默认情况下显示,并且它们的各种颜色和样式都没有问题。使用以下代码,按钮将正确隐藏进度条。
function showhide() {
var x = document.getElementsByClassName("showhideclass");
var i;
for (i = 0; i < x.length; i ++) {
if (x[i].style.display === "none"
我有一个JS和引导程序内置的进度条,代码如下所示
var totalCountries = 10;
var currentCountries = 0;
var $progressbar = $("#progressbar");
$("#next, #next1").on("click", function(){
if (currentCountries >= totalCountries){ return; }
currentCountries++;
$progressbar.css("width", Math
我在第三方库的帮助下创建了一个React进度条。
import React from "react";
import { css } from "@emotion/core";
import ClipLoader from "react-spinners/ClipLoader";
// Can be a string as well. Need to ensure each key-value pair ends with ;
const override = css`
display: block;
margin: 0 auto
根据用户操作,我需要进行从一个调用到三个并行调用的ajax调用。我也想显示进度条。一个进度条用于任意数量的Ajax请求。下面是我要调整的示例代码。谁能建议我如何限制呼叫的数量,以及如何使用一个进度条来实现这一点。
$.when(
// Get the HTML
$.get("/feature/", function(html) {
globalStore.html = html;
}),
// Get the CSS
$.get("/assets/feature.css", function(css) {
globalStore.css =
我有一个进度条,它在单击submit之后运行。
然后,应用程序将处理后台任务并更新进度条。
问题是,如何在进度条达到100%之后显示下载按钮,而不是在进度条开始更新时显示该按钮?
$('form').on('submit', function(event) {
event.preventDefault();
var formData = new FormData(this);
// add task status elements
div = $('<div class="progress"><div&g
简而言之,我试图做的是,只有几个按钮和一个单一的进度条,它对每个按钮的反应不同。我试着得到一个按钮的值,然后做一个if语句,但是变量返回NaN。我搞不懂..。
function progressBarAbs() {
var html_bar = document.getElementById("bar");
var width = 1;
var interval = setInterval(progressIntents, 10);
function progressIntents() {
var button = $("button
我有一个模式,当一个按钮被点击。当计时器到时,模式弹出并关闭,当前为5秒。然而,我想创建一个进度条,显示计时器下降,没有数字,只是一个移动的条。
这是我已经拥有的:。您必须单击模式的“管理”按钮。
这是我想要实现的目标。我知道我的Photoshop技能不是很到位,我很着急:
底部的白条是进度条。
我确实试过了,但不适合我需要的东西,所以不起作用。
var start = new Date();
var maxTime = 835000;
var timeoutVal = Math.floor(maxTime/100);
animateUpdate();
function upd